No. 19 Purdue Stifles Butler, 85-59

WEST LAFAYETTE, Ind. (AP) - Jodi Howell scored nine of her 14 points during a 28-5 first-half run, leading No. 19 Purdue to an 85-59 victory over Butler on Friday night.

Aya Traore also had 14 points, and Erin Lawless added 12 for the Boilermakers (1-0). Ellen Hamilton led Butler (0-1) with 19 points.

Howell, who was Indiana's high school Miss Basketball last season, didn't start in her Purdue debut but took over midway through the first half when the Boilermakers began pulling away from the Division I-AA Bulldogs with ease.

The freshman guard was fouled on her first shot, a 3-point attempt, and made all three free throws to give Purdue a 23-9 lead. Then, after a fast-break basket by Butler's Jackie Closser, Howell's former high school teammate, the Bulldogs managed only three free throws over the next 6 minutes.

Howell hit two 3-pointers during that span, the second one starting a 15-0 run that gave Purdue its biggest lead of the half at 43-14. Candace Bain and Hamilton hit 3-pointers for Butler in the closing minutes of the half, but Katie Gearlds scored a basket and Howell finished the period with two more free throws for a 47-20 lead at the break.

Five of Butler's first eight baskets of the second half were 3-pointers, including four by Hamilton, and the Bulldogs cut the lead to 20 points before another 3-pointer by Howell with 4 minutes to go.

Closser added 10 points for Butler.
